Obituary for Deloris Jean Gillaspy (Dobbins)

Ratliff City - Graveside Services for Mrs. Deloris Jean (Dobbins) Gillaspy, 83 are scheduled for 11:00 A.M., Tuesday, August 30, 2022 at the Alma Cemetery with Pastor Mike King officiating. Services are under the care and direction of Alexander Gray Funeral Home in Ratliff City.

Deloris was born October 5, 1938 in Morgantown, WV to the late Mr. Wayts Dobbins and Mrs. Cora (Hardman) Dobbins. She departed from this life on Friday, August 26, 2022 in Duncan, OK.

Deloris was raised in West Virginia attending school there and where she graduated high school. She had lived in Ohio, California before making her home in Oklahoma in 1973. She married Mr. Cecil Gillaspy and together they raised their three children, Debbie, Ray, and Butch. He preceded her in death on February 26, 1990. Deloris worked at the pants factory in Ringling for a short while in the 1980's and had also worked for several local restaurants, lastly working for the Velma Public School as a cook. She enjoyed going out to eat especially with the girls on each one of their birthdays every year and then going to the casinos. Deloris really enjoyed and loved being with her grandchildren.

Preceded her in death were her parents; husband, Cecil; and a son, Butch Gillaspy in August of 1998.

Deloris is survived by her daughter, Debbie Wilson of Duncan; son, Ray Gillaspy and wife Carla of Ratliff City; granddaughter, Tasha Cisneroz and husband Noel of Comanche; great grandchildren, Kaidence, Thomas, Jax, and Ellie Cisneroz; special friends, Linda Wright, Laverne Dulworth and Burneze Mullins; and by a host of other family and friends.
